The social assistance market size has grown strongly in recent years. It will grow from $1.68 trillion in 2024 to $1.79 trillion in 2025 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.7%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to social welfare programs, economic factors, aging population, healthcare services.
The social assistance market size is expected to see strong growth in the next few years. It will grow to $2.29 trillion in 2029 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.3%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to demographic shifts, economic recovery and resilience, mental health services, childcare services, substance abuse and addiction services. Major trends in the forecast period include digital transformation, mental health and wellness support, childcare and early childhood education, technology-enabled social assistance, community engagement and volunteerism.

The increasing geriatric population is expected to drive the growth of the social assistance market in the coming years. The geriatric population refers to individuals aged 65 or older. As this demographic expands, the demand for social assistance services, such as home healthcare and nursing homes, is anticipated to grow, as these services provide essential medical care and support for elderly individuals in their homes. For example, in January 2023, the United Nations Department of Economic and Social Affairs, a U.S.-based think tank of the UN, projected that the global population of people aged 65 or older will more than double, rising from 761 million in 2021 to 1.6 billion by 2050. Additionally, the population of individuals aged 80 and above is expected to grow at an even faster rate. As a result, the rise in the geriatric population is driving the demand for social assistance services.
Social assistance providers are increasingly adopting data-driven approaches, including big data and predictive analytics, to gain insights related to their services. Predictive analytics involves the use of data, statistical algorithms, and machine learning to identify the likelihood of future outcomes based on historical data. Big data analytics focuses on extracting hidden patterns and valuable information from large datasets. These approaches assist in reporting, detecting, and addressing non-compliance while monitoring the target population. For instance, Hillside Family of Agencies, which provides services for youth and families, uses predictive analytics to reduce high school dropout rates among youth. The Good Samaritan Society, a non-profit senior care provider, has partnered with IBM to leverage big data and analytics software for analyzing clinical and operational data related to patients.

Social assistance refers to supportive services offered by public institutions, designed to complement or go beyond social security benefits, ensuring that individuals lacking sufficient resources have their basic needs met. The primary goal of social assistance is to support the poorest and most vulnerable populations, helping them achieve a minimum standard of living.
The primary categories within the social assistance sector include child daycare services and community and individual services. Child daycare services involve the care of infants or children, offered either in the child's home, the registered child caregiver's home, or in a child care center. The social assistance market consists of revenues earned by entities that provides social assistance services such as community food housing and relief services, vocational rehabilitation services and individual and family services. Social assistance establishments do not include residential or accommodation services, except on a short-day basis stay. This market includes both government sponsored and privately funded social assistance services. The market value includes the value of related goods sold by the service provider or included within the service offering. Only goods and services traded between entities or sold to end consumers are included.
The market value is defined as the revenues that enterprises gain from the sale of goods and/or services within the specified market and geography through sales, grants, or donations in terms of the currency (in USD, unless otherwise specified).
The revenues for a specified geography are consumption values that are revenues generated by organizations in the specified geography within the market, irrespective of where they are produced. It does not include revenues from resales along the supply chain, either further along the supply chain or as part of other products.
